Q: Is 173,204 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 173,204 is not a prime number.

Why is 173,204 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 173204 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 19 38 43 53 76 86 106 172 212 817 1,007 1,634 2,014 2,279 3,268 4,028 4,558 9,116 43,301 86,602 and 173,204, with no remainder.

Since 173,204 cannot be divided by just 1 and 173,204, it is not a prime number.
